Output 7c30792f614b966fca54b8d4ea00c1c08c3fb9a6184f0058be44d34f34450fb3:5

value
59939706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fbb0927d63d6bdaf98e42f270a2e5444d9d4b04 OP_EQUAL
address
MUJ8ygTS7UX85fzQ33KEd3kJf9v8Mcp2eQ
transaction
7c30792f614b966fca54b8d4ea00c1c08c3fb9a6184f0058be44d34f34450fb3
spent
true